Fiberglass vs. Steel Entry Doors: A Humidity Comparison
Humidity is one of those conditions that exposes door materials quickly. Both materials can be smart choices, but humidity changes the trade-offs.
The real issue is how each door behaves when heat, rain, and humidity hit the front entry every week for months. That is where the differences start to matter.
For homes where humidity is a constant, fiberglass usually earns points for staying straight and predictable. The finish can age, and hardware still needs care, but the door slab itself is not especially sensitive to damp air.
Steel doors, by comparison, are strong and secure, and they can perform well in humid climates if they are properly built and maintained. Once the outer finish is compromised, damp air and water intrusion become a bigger problem.
In humid regions, a dent at the bottom edge or a nick near the hardware can become more than cosmetic if it is ignored. That is why steel doors need regular inspections for scratches, failed paint, and signs of corrosion around seams and hardware.
Fiberglass doors are not immune to problems, especially if water gets behind the cladding or if the frame and weatherstripping are poorly installed. The most common complaints are finish wear, discoloration, or minor sealing issues rather than structural distortion.

A door that sticks may be blamed on steel versus fiberglass, when the frame is out of square or the threshold is allowing water in. In other words, a good installation can make an average door perform well, while a bad installation can ruin a premium one.
If you want the least sensitivity to moisture and the most stable everyday performance, fiberglass usually has the edge. Fiberglass also tends to be more forgiving for painted finishes, while steel can offer a crisp look at a lower entry cost in some cases.
A few real-world conditions help narrow the choice. If the home sees frequent condensation or long damp stretches, fiberglass is typically the safer bet for maintaining alignment. If the existing frame is already troubled by moisture, the door material alone will not solve the problem.
A cold surface meeting warm, moist air can collect moisture on either material if the entry is not sealed well. That is why weatherstripping, insulation around the frame, and proper door adjustment matter so much.

Steel can still be a good entry door material, but it asks more from the finish and from maintenance. A sheltered entry, a well-built frame, and careful installation can make either option perform well.
